首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何实现从pandas到postgresql的快速查询

从pandas到PostgreSQL的快速查询可以通过以下步骤实现:

  1. 首先,确保已经安装了pandas和psycopg2库。可以使用以下命令安装它们:
  2. 首先,确保已经安装了pandas和psycopg2库。可以使用以下命令安装它们:
  3. 导入所需的库:
  4. 导入所需的库:
  5. 连接到PostgreSQL数据库:
  6. 连接到PostgreSQL数据库:
  7. 其中,"your_database"是数据库名称,"your_username"和"your_password"是数据库的用户名和密码,"your_host"和"your_port"是数据库的主机地址和端口号。
  8. 从pandas DataFrame导入数据到PostgreSQL数据库:
  9. 从pandas DataFrame导入数据到PostgreSQL数据库:
  10. 其中,"your_table"是你要导入数据的表名。使用if_exists='replace'参数可以在导入数据之前先删除已存在的表。
  11. 执行查询语句:
  12. 执行查询语句:
  13. 在"your_table"后面的WHERE子句中填入你的查询条件。
  14. 关闭数据库连接:
  15. 关闭数据库连接:

这样,你就可以通过pandas将数据从DataFrame导入到PostgreSQL,并执行快速查询了。

推荐的腾讯云相关产品:腾讯云数据库PostgreSQL,它是一种高性能、可扩展的云原生关系型数据库,提供了丰富的功能和工具来管理和查询数据。你可以通过以下链接了解更多信息: 腾讯云数据库PostgreSQ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

通过python实现从csv文件PostgreSQL数据写入

正在规划一个指标库,用到了PostgresSQL,花了一周做完数据初始化,准备导入PostgreSQL,通过向导导入总是报错,通过python沿用之前方式也有问题,只好参考网上案例进行摸索。...PostgreSQL是一种特性非常齐全自由软件对象-关系型数据库管理系统(ORDBMS),是以加州大学计算机系开发POSTGRES,4.2版本为基础对象关系型数据库管理系统。...PostgreSQL支持大部分SQL标准并且提供了很多其他现代特性,如复杂查询、外键、触发器、视图、事务完整性、多版本并发控制等。...同样,PostgreSQL也可以用许多方法扩展,例如通过增加新数据类型、函数、操作符、聚集函数、索引方法、过程语言等。...另外,因为许可证灵活,任何人都可以以任何目的免费使用、修改和分发PostgreSQLPostgreSQL和Python交互是通过psycopg2包进行

2.6K20

“数字客服”:如何现从成本价值转变

与此同时,金融行业同客户多样化生活场景息息相关且涉及金额有时较大,因此从客户角度出发,其对金融机构服务需求量及服务质量要求就会比较高。...:实现按需供应计算资源,使得技术和资源能够以弹性灵活方式得到充分利用,并同时降低客服运营成本; RPA:快速、自动完成客服运营体系中标准化程度相对较高流程,且操作准确率高、服务质量稳定性强,更多客服人力和时间将被释放...:将客户体验延展业务价值链和客户全生命周期。...如在金融行业,目前传统金融机构正着力建立普惠金融服务生态环境,从生活场景、客户需求、再到银行产品,服务正日益深入客户真实生活。...与此同时,从售前售后,客服中心职能定位也日益复杂,这就对客户服务提出了新高要求。新客服将助力传统金融机构加速渠道融通、升级自助服务能力、优化客服中心效能并持续提升营销与风控管理精度。

72900
  • 如何通过 CloudCanal 实现从 Kafka AutoMQ 数据迁移

    接下来,我将以增量同步为例,详细介绍如何使用 CloudCanal 实现从 Kafka AutoMQ 数据迁移,确保数据在迁移过程中保持一致和完整。...->Kafka 数据同步过程,参考:MySQL Kafka 同步 | CloudCanal 8通过 Kafka SDK 准备数据通过 Kafka 提供脚本手动生产消息这里我将通过 Kafka SDK...| ExecutionException e) {            e.printStackTrace();        }    }    // 为50个 Topic-n 分别发送序号从11000...验证 AutoMQ 中是否已经正确创建了 Topic 结构图片4.4 准备增量数据任务已经正常运行,接下来我们需要准备增量数据,使得迁移任务能够将增量数据同步 AutoMQ。...通过本文介绍,我们详细探讨了如何利用 CloudCanal 实现从 Kafka AutoMQ 增量同步数据迁移,以应对存储成本和运维复杂性问题。

    10210

    10快速入门Query函数使用Pandas查询示例

    pandas.query函数为我们提供了一种编写查询过滤条件更简单方法,特别是在查询条件很多时候,在本文中整理了10个示例,掌握着10个实例你就可以轻松使用query函数来解决任何查询问题。...在开始之前,先快速回顾一下pandas -中查询函数query。查询函数用于根据指定表达式提取记录,并返回一个新DataFrame。表达式是用字符串形式表示条件或条件组合。...PANDAS DATAFRAME(.loc和.iloc)属性用于根据行和列标签和索引提取数据集子集。因此,它并不具备查询灵活性。...那么如何在另一个字符串中写一个字符串?...OrderDate.dt.month显示了如何使用DT访问者仅提取整个日期值月份值。

    4.5K10

    10个快速入门Query函数使用Pandas查询示例

    pandas.query函数为我们提供了一种编写查询过滤条件更简单方法,特别是在查询条件很多时候,在本文中整理了10个示例,掌握着10个实例你就可以轻松使用query函数来解决任何查询问题。...在开始之前,先快速回顾一下pandas -中查询函数query。查询函数用于根据指定表达式提取记录,并返回一个新DataFrame。表达式是用字符串形式表示条件或条件组合。...在后端pandas使用eval()函数对该表达式进行解析和求值,并返回表达式被求值为TRUE数据子集或记录。所以要过滤pandas DataFrame,需要做就是在查询函数中指定条件即可。...那么如何在另一个字符串中写一个字符串?将文本值包装在单个引号“”中,就可以了。...OrderDate.dt.month显示了如何使用DT访问者仅提取整个日期值月份值。

    4.4K20

    快速解释如何使用pandasinplace参数

    介绍 在操作dataframe时,初学者有时甚至是更高级数据科学家会对如何pandas中使用inplace参数感到困惑。 更有趣是,我看到解释这个概念文章或教程并不多。...它似乎被假定为知识或自我解释概念。不幸是,这对每个人来说都不是那么简单,因此本文试图解释什么是inplace参数以及如何正确使用它。...我没有记住所有这些函数,但是作为参数几乎所有pandas DataFrame函数都将以类似的方式运行。这意味着在处理它们时,您将能够应用本文将介绍相同逻辑。...现在我们将演示dropna()函数如何使用inplace参数工作。因为我们想要检查两个不同变体,所以我们将创建原始数据框架两个副本。...我不太确定,可能是因为有些人还不知道如何正确使用这个参数。让我们看看一些常见错误。

    2.4K20

    如何应对业务复杂变更,实现从CICD全领域CMDB演进?

    这种情况下,会采用原型简单、扩展性好、松耦合、简洁易用,快速迭代架构设计来满足需求。...传统研发模式痛点 受限于人员、流程、技术间沟通及工作对接间时效问题,传统研发模式痛点愈发突出,导致传统IT服务支撑难以满足业务快速、稳定交付要求。...如何应对复杂变更?全领域CMDB登场 为了更好地应对来自敏捷双模IT理念提出需求和挑战,IT研发需从敏捷治理和稳定可靠两方面,双管齐下,同步关注企业及IT业务发展。...从CI/CD全领域CMDB演进过程 整体演进过程通常划分标准化-模板化-平台化-数据化四个过程: 第一步:奠定基石 实现标准化,达成统一组织与规范体系目的。...未来展望 从CI/CO全域CMDB未来,可从两方面进行规划: 智能化调整模板: 基于应用热度,进行智能推荐,经过算法进行系列调整。

    64220

    如何完成一次快速查询

    谁不想完成一次快速查询? 1. MySQL查询慢是什么体验? 大多数互联网应用场景都是读多写少,业务逻辑更多分布在写上。对读要求大概就是要快。那么都有什么原因会导致我们完成一次出色查询呢?...1.1.5 如何评价 MySQL 选错了索引 有时,建立了猛一看挺正确索引,但事情却没按计划发展。就像“为啥 XXX 有索引,根据它查询还是慢查询”。...而 ES 在 Term Dictionary 基础上多了层 Term Index ,它以 FST 形式保存在内存中,保存着 term 前缀,借此可以快速定位 Term dictionary 本...3.4 使用场景 HBASE 并非适用于实时快速查询。它更适合写密集型场景,它拥用快速写入能力,而查询对于单条或小面积查询是 OK ,当然也只能根据 rowkey。...但它性能和可靠性非常高,不存在单点故障。 4. 总结 个人觉得软件开发是循序渐进,技术服务于项目,合适比新颖复杂更重要。 如何完成一次快速查询

    1K11

    如何快速搭建漏洞环境复现PoC

    1 docker快速搭建环境思路 Docker是个好东西,希望你有一个。 Docker出现不止在开发领域,在安全领域也有很多用处,最基础就是漏洞环境了。...之前我也写过一系列低级文章来描述docker使用,以及docker怎么快速搭建漏洞环境。...今天就来一篇实战和说一些高级用法~ 之前我说过能快速搭建起漏洞环境才是王道,至于你搞出来容器像不像一些大牛github上开源漏洞环境dockerfile那么优雅。...倒不是重点了~ 用最挫办法docker cp+docker commit完成得比别人快,比别人更快复现不就行了,能够快速复现出PoC你时效性就高,攻防是争分夺秒。...你搜索这个漏洞插件那么wordpress官方就会把你定位一个官方安全插件,PV。 ? 搜索存在漏洞插件推荐以下网站,大部分都能找到

    2.9K10

    如何使用慢查询快速定位执行慢 SQL?

    查询可以帮我们找到执行慢 SQL,在使用前,我们需要先看下慢查询是否已经开启,使用下面这条命令即可: mysql > show variables like '%slow_query_log';...我们能看到slow_query_log=OFF,也就是说慢查询日志此时是关上。...,以及慢查询日志文件位置: ?...我们可以使用 MySQL 自带 mysqldumpslow 工具统计慢查询日志(这个工具是个 Perl 脚本,你需要先安装好 Perl) mysqldumpslow 命令具体参数如下: -s:采用...你能看到开启了慢查询日志,并设置了相应查询时间阈值之后,只要查询时间大于这个阈值 SQL 语句都会保存在慢查询日志中,然后我们就可以通过 mysqldumpslow 工具提取想要查找 SQL 语句了

    2.6K20

    如何使用慢查询快速定位执行慢 SQL?

    查询可以帮我们找到执行慢 SQL,在使用前,我们需要先看下慢查询是否已经开启,使用下面这条命令即可: mysql > show variables like '%slow_query_log';...我们能看到slow_query_log=OFF,也就是说慢查询日志此时是关上。...,以及慢查询日志文件位置: 你能看到这时慢查询分析已经开启,同时文件保存在 DESKTOP-4BK02RP-slow 文件中。...mysqldumpslow 工具统计慢查询日志(这个工具是个 Perl 脚本,你需要先安装好 Perl) mysqldumpslow 命令具体参数如下: -s:采用 order 排序方式,排序方式可以有以下几种...比如我们想要按照查询时间排序,查看前两条 SQL 语句,这样写即可: 你能看到开启了慢查询日志,并设置了相应查询时间阈值之后,只要查询时间大于这个阈值 SQL 语句都会保存在慢查询日志中,然后我们就可以通过

    2.7K10

    高并发下如何完成一次快速查询

    如果查询条件包含在了组合索引中,比如存在组合索引(a,b),查询满足 a 记录后会直接在索引内部判断 b 是否满足,减少回表次数。同时,如果查询列恰好包含在组合索引中,即为覆盖索引,无需回表。...1.1.5 如何评价 MySQL 选错了索引 有时,建立了猛一看挺正确索引,但事情却没按计划发展。就像“为啥 XXX 有索引,根据它查询还是慢查询”。...而 ES 在 Term Dictionary 基础上多了层 Term Index ,它以 FST 形式保存在内存中,保存着 term 前缀,借此可以快速定位 Term dictionary 本...3.4 使用场景 HBASE 并非适用于实时快速查询。它更适合写密集型场景,它拥用快速写入能力,而查询对于单条或小面积查询是 OK ,当然也只能根据 rowkey。...但它性能和可靠性非常高,不存在单点故障。 4. 总结 个人觉得软件开发是循序渐进,技术服务于项目,合适比新颖复杂更重要。 如何完成一次快速查询

    95330

    如何让你分析报告更具洞察力 ?实现从数据观点五点分享!

    对于数据分析团队人员来说,把数据导入网站软件分析占据在工作量小于10%,而把剩下90%时间用在发现数据中价值,形成自己观点从而驱动公司作为改变,这才是数据分析师价值。 ?...那么,数据分析师们如何现从数字观点,以下是我五点建议: 1、不仅要对比差异,而且要对比趋势 网站分析软件让分析师去对比连续数据,例如:按月、按年来比较变成很容易,但是对于一些逻辑上比较,例如:...然而,最好发现趋势方法还是把数据导入excel中,通过透视表去发现数据中趋势。...有的时候为了回答一个数据变化,你可能需要花很大精力去研究。然而,通过对数据细分(数据行业有一句话:无细分,吾宁死),您可以快速找到影响未来趋势变化共享行为特征。...对于测试少于整体网站流量1%修改是行不通,同时对于那些超越公司可控范围内改变也是不合理。 你如何让你分析报告更具洞察力 ?欢迎分享您意见和想法! 内容来源:中国统计网翻译小组

    61470

    如何快速获取AWR中涉及

    最近遇到一个很少见需求,是关于应用测试方面的。 具体来说,这个应用测试需求要基于一个固定时间点数据,而且只能测试一轮,再测试就需要还原测试前状态。...因为我们使用存储是分层(热数据在Flash上,冷数据在传统机械盘),但因为每次测试都需要将数据库闪回还原固定时间点,效果不佳,所以需要尽可能预热测试涉及对象。...尽可能找更多AWR中SQL,收集相关表进行预热 如果是第一种方式,需要人工去定位,SQL数量会很少几条。...u 预热方式: --全表扫描hints select /*+ full(a) */ count(*) from Z_OBJ a; Tips: 若使用Exadata一体机,还可以同时选择将该表keep...flash中: alter table Z_OBJ storage(cell_flash_cache keep);

    15130

    知乎高赞:有哪些你看了以后大呼过瘾数据分析书?

    1 深入浅出Pandas 利用Python进行数据处理与分析 作者:李庆辉 推荐语:《Python编程:从入门实践》《零基础学Python》《利用Python进行数据分析》学习伴侣,用好Python...Python工程师案头必不可少查询手册。...6 金融商业数据分析:基于Python和SAS 作者:张秋剑 张浩 周大川 常国珍 推荐语:腾讯云等资深数据架构师、商业分析师20年经验,全流程讲解金融数据分析思路、方法、技巧,快速入门精通。...它将指导读者零基础掌握金融数据分析工具、思路、方法和技巧,快速现从入门进阶突破。...7 ECharts数据可视化:入门、实战与进阶 作者:王大伟 推荐语:ECharts官方推荐,系统全面、由浅入深、注重操,带领读者快速从新人高手。

    1.4K20

    如何用LogQL在几秒内快速查询TB级日志

    但是,当涉及在过滤海量日志时,我们就像面临在大海捞针一样复杂。LogQL是Loki特有的语句,在本文中,我们将提供LogQL快速过滤器查询技巧,这些查询可以在几秒钟内过滤掉数TB数据。...,是大幅减少你搜索日志数量(例如,从100TB1TB)最好方法。...如果匹配器包含一个或多个字元,比如{container=~"promtail|agent"},同时只有一个单一regex匹配器,Loki可以自行优化查询 下面就是一些实用样例: 好例子: {cluster...比如下面这个也一个很好查询方式 {namespace="prod"} |= "traceID=2e2er8923100" 如果你想让这个traceID所有日志都符合某个regex,可以在ID过滤器后面加上...+/query",这样就不会对prod命名空间每个pod中去添加查询

    2K40

    「镁客·请讲」准确率高达97%,AI问答机器人如何现从 B端 C端跨越?

    此前,易用车用智能客服取代人工客服一事引起了业内关注,也将“智能客服”概念推到了舆论中心。 早在2013年,国内市场相继涌现出了诸如Udesk、智齿科技等一大批智能客服创业公司。...“截止2013上半年,我们平台上已经拥有了数千客户群体,甚至有人主动要求付费,期望对一些功能进行个性优化。”茆传羽介绍说。...正是在拥有众多B端行业客户基础上,云问科技获得了大量数据,做出了最全面和最真实用户画像。基于此,云问科技能够通过深入分析,发现数据背后更多隐藏价值,从而为客户制定最精准营销推广。...不过,借助于B端客户和数据沉淀,他们也在寻求进一步突破。 “我们通过一个很小切入点进入一家企业,进而获得客户需求、喜好等一系列数据,从而能够进行互动化营销、精准化推荐。...由此来看,虽然定位为“AI问答机器人”,但是不管是当前走势,还是未来规划,云问科技想做似乎不仅仅是单纯意义上“问答机器人”,而是会利用当下深耕B端市场所获得数据,让AI问答机器人跳出局限,向用户提供更多智能化服务

    60230

    DBever SQL编辑器高级应用:如何用变量快速查询

    其中,它SQL编辑器功能非常强大,可以让更方便地进行SQL语句编写和执行。今天,就来探讨一下DBever SQL编辑器中如何使用变量方式。...二、如何在DBever SQL编辑器中使用变量在DBever SQL编辑器中,可以使用@set命令来定义一个变量,然后在SQL语句中使用这个变量。...这样,就可以避免在SQL语句中直接写死app_id值,从而提高了代码可读性和可维护性。三、变量使用场景在实际开发工作中,经常会遇到需要在多个地方使用相同情况。...例如,当需要对多个表进行相同字段更新时,就可以使用变量来存储这些相同值。这样,就可以只需要修改一处定义变量地方,就可以在所有使用到这个值地方自动获取到最新值。...这样,就可以避免在代码中直接操作用户输入数据,从而提高了代码安全性。五、结语以上就是DBever SQL编辑器中如何使用变量方法。

    14910
    领券